如何在 WebStorm 中同时调试服务器和客户端?
How do I debug server and client simultaneously in WebStorm?
我有一个运行服务器并发送 index.html 的 node.js 应用程序。 index.html 与服务器交互。
我想调试完整的应用程序,但是当我调试应用程序时,WebStorm 只调试服务器。
这在 WebStorm 中甚至可能吗?如果没有,是否有其他工具可以做到这一点?
在 Node.js run configuration, Browser/Live Edit 选项卡中,指定服务器的 URL,勾选 After launch 和 with JavaScript debugger 复选框 - 一旦您使用此配置启动节点服务器,client-side 调试器就会启动,这样您就可以使用单个 运行 配置同时调试两者。
另请参阅 https://www.jetbrains.com/help/webstorm/debugging-javascript-in-chrome.html#debugging_js_on_external_web_server 以获取有关在浏览器中调试 client-side 代码 运行 的一些提示
我有一个运行服务器并发送 index.html 的 node.js 应用程序。 index.html 与服务器交互。
我想调试完整的应用程序,但是当我调试应用程序时,WebStorm 只调试服务器。
这在 WebStorm 中甚至可能吗?如果没有,是否有其他工具可以做到这一点?
在 Node.js run configuration, Browser/Live Edit 选项卡中,指定服务器的 URL,勾选 After launch 和 with JavaScript debugger 复选框 - 一旦您使用此配置启动节点服务器,client-side 调试器就会启动,这样您就可以使用单个 运行 配置同时调试两者。
另请参阅 https://www.jetbrains.com/help/webstorm/debugging-javascript-in-chrome.html#debugging_js_on_external_web_server 以获取有关在浏览器中调试 client-side 代码 运行 的一些提示